S. 79 and S. 115JB — In computing book profit u/s.115JB, lower of brought forward loss or unabsorbed depreciation to be reduced, irrespective of whether allowable u/s.79

10 (2008) 117 TTJ 891 (Ahd.)

Fascel Ltd. v. ITO

ITA No. 1195 (Ahd.) of 2007

A.Y. : 2003-04. Dated : 17-8-2007

S. 79 and S. 115JB of the Income-tax Act, 1961 — In arriving
at the book profit u/s.115JB, the lower of the amount of brought forward loss or
unabsorbed depreciation as appearing in the books of account of the assessee has
to be reduced, irrespective of the fact whether the same is allowable u/s.79 or
not.

 


While computing the book profit u/s.115JB for A.Y. 2003-04,
the Assessing Officer held that since there was a substantial change in
shareholding in A.Y. 2000-01, the provisions of S. 79 were attracted. Therefore,
the brought forward loss/depreciation up to A.Y. 2000-01 is not to be carried
forward for computing the business income as well as for the purposes of S.
115JB. The Assessing Officer also held that there is no direct case law on the
subject, but logic demands that prohibition u/s.79 shall apply both to normal
computation u/s.28 to u/s.43C as well as u/s.115JB. The CIT(A) upheld the
Assessing Officer’s order.


 

The Tribunal held in favour of the assessee. The Tribunal
noted as under :

(a) Clause (iii) of the Explanation to S. 115JB(2)
specifically provides that the amount of loss brought forward or unabsorbed
depreciation as per the books of account is to be reduced from the book profit
and it is lower of the two amounts that is to be reduced. It is the amount
which is as per the books of accounts that is to be reduced and not as per the
income-tax records which has been computed under the provisions of the Act.


(b) The admissibility of loss as per other provisions of
the Act has nothing to do with the computation of book profit and that is made
clear by the provisions of clause (iii) of the Explanation. If it is appearing
in the books of accounts and not set off in the subsequent year’s profit, the
effect is to be given in the impugned year of profit while computing the book
profit of the assessee.
